|
3.1Visual FoxPro的常量發表時間:2020-03-05 10:45 3.1 Visual FoxPro的常量一、常量的認識 1、常量是表示一個確定的數據,如65.8等。 2、Visual FoxPro中,常量的類型有數值型、貨幣型、字符型、邏輯型、日期型、日期時間型6種。
二、數值型常量 1、數值型常量表示的是一個具體的數,因此,數值型常量也稱為常數。 2、數值型常量的表示 ·日常表示法 如12、+56、-64.8等。 ·科學表示法 1.6E12表示1.6×1012; 1.6E-12表示1.6×10-12; -1.6E12表示-1.6×1012; -1.6E-12表示-1.6×10-12。
三、貨幣型常量 1、貨幣型常量用來表示一個具體的貨幣值。貨幣型常量的小數位數最多4位。 2、貨幣型常量的表示 如$12,$12.68,-$12.68等。
四、字符型常量 1、字符型常量用來表示一串字符(數字、符號、漢字統稱為字符),因此,字符型常量也稱為字符串。 2、字符型常量的表示 如'abcd'、"abcd"、[abcd]均表示字符串abcd。 3、說明 ·表示字符型常量前后的'、"或[]稱為字符型常量的定界符,它表示字符串的開始和結束,不是字符串的組成內容。字符串的前后定界符必須一致,如'abcd"等是錯誤的。 ·當字符串中包含定界符時,必須使用與之不同的定界符作為字符串的定界符,如字符串ab'cd應表示為"ab'cd"或[ab'cd]。 ·字符型常量中的字母大小寫是區分的,比如"abcd"和"ABCD"是不同的兩個字符串。 注意:其他場合,字母的大小寫是不區分的。 ·組成字符串的內容中可以有空格,如"ab cd"、"a bc d"、" "等都是正確的字符串。 ·定界符中沒有任何內容時,也是正確的字符串,這樣的字符串稱為空串。 注意:空串并不是指全部由空格組成的字符串。
五、邏輯型常量 1、邏輯型常量用來表示一個邏輯值。邏輯值只有兩個:真值和假值。 2、邏輯型常量的表示 真值:.T. 、.t. 、.Y. 、.y. 假值:.F. 、.f. 、.N. 、.n.
六、日期型常量 1、日期型常量用來表示一個日期。 2、日期型常量的表示 如2010年12月9日可表示為: {^2010-12-9}、{^2010.12.9}、{^2010/12/9}、{^2010 12 9}。 說明:這種表示格式不受系統當前日期格式的影響。
七、日期時間型常量 1、日期時間型常量用來表示一個日期和時間。 2、日期時間型常量的表示 格式:{^日期,時間} 其中,日期的書寫格式與日期型常量中的日期格式相同,時間的書寫格式有:8:30:30、18:15:25、8:10:30A、8:10:30AM、8:10:30P、8:10:30PM。
文章分類:
教學資料
|
掃描查看手機版網站